Rating: 1
Summary: Revictimization
Comment: I have only read portions of this book... and what I've read of it exemplifies a punitive and callous approach to working with trauma survivors. Making an analogy to Frankenstein for a trauma survivor experiencing intimacy/relational difficulties serves to revictimize trauma survivors. Also, I think this book is quite reductionistic... and frankly serves to categorize trauma survivors' diverse relational transactions as "trauma reactions." This unfortunately can be fuel for partners who read this book to label any and all of a trauma survivor's thoughts, opinions, and feelings (especially if slightly intense) to be "trauma reactions." Then, the partner can in essence blame the abuse-surviving parter for relationship difficulties which may have absolutely nothing to do with the trauma. This book can be quite damaging in its simplicity.
